Project Update |Fournée Bakery, Berkeley

When Frank, owner of Fournée Bakery, first contacted us he presented us with a black and white picture of a hand drawn logo. The new bakery which will soon open in Berkeley has beautiful glass front windows and doors. As we began to explore colors options and sizing, it became apparent that Frank wanted a very upscale look. We had suggested modern metallic gold lettering, but Frank decided on hammered gold leaf which is one of the more expensive specialty vinyls. It is a high end yet stately look that appeals to traditional buyers who want to make a statement.

Window lettering is somewhat of a staple when it comes to the retail storefront but gold leaf provides and eye catching and upscale alternative that stands out. Similar effects exist in silver and there is mirrored chrome that is becoming popular. The brand we used carries a 5 year durability rating.
